  • Patent number: 11726176
    Abstract: A radar-data collection system a radar, a camera, and a controller-circuit. The radar and the camera are intended for mounting on a host-vehicle. The radar is configured is to indicate a radar-profile of an object detected by the radar. The camera is configured to render an image of the object. The controller-circuit is in communication with the radar and the camera. The controller is configured to determine an identity of the object in accordance with the image, and annotate the radar-profile in accordance with the identity.

  • Patent number: 10896514
    Abstract: A system for operating a vehicle includes an object-detector and a controller-circuit. The object-detector is used to track an object traveling on a roadway traveled by a host-vehicle. The controller-circuit is in communication with the object-detector. The controller-circuit is configured to track a position of the object, and determine a classification of the object in accordance with a signal received from the object-detector. The classification includes a car and a bicycle. The controller-circuit is configured to track the car a first-distance after the car turns off the roadway, track the bicycle a second-distance after the bicycle turns off the roadway, where the second-distance is greater than the first-distance, and operate the host-vehicle in accordance with the position of the object.
